Exploring Core Features and Functions
Modern kitchen textiles encompass a variety of products, including dish towels, aprons, pot holders, table linens, and more, all designed to enhance the cooking experience. These textiles are not only aesthetically pleasing but also functional. Typically crafted from organic cotton, hemp, bamboo, or recycled materials, they are engineered to resist stains, maintain vibrant colors through multiple washes, and offer superior durability. The use of non-toxic dyes and production processes further ensures that these textiles are safe for both the environment and human health.
One standout feature of modern kitchen textiles is their ability to absorb moisture well, making them practical for everyday use. Advanced technologies, such as moisture-wicking and antimicrobial treatments, enhance their usability, enabling users to maintain cleanliness and hygiene in the kitchen with ease.
Advantages and Application Scenarios
The advantages of using modern kitchen textiles are manifold. Firstly, their sustainable nature can significantly reduce environmental impact. By choosing textiles made from organic or recycled materials, consumers can decrease waste and support eco-friendly farming practices. Furthermore, these products often last longer than traditional textile options, thereby reducing the need for frequent replacements and overall resource consumption.
In terms of application scenarios, modern kitchen textiles are incredibly versatile. They are perfect not only for home kitchens but also for professional environments such as restaurants, cafes, and catering companies. Their stylish designs can elevate dining experiences, making them ideal for both casual and formal settings. For instance, a chic set of table linens made from sustainable materials can enhance a restaurant's ambiance while solidifying its commitment to sustainability.

Future Development Potential and Suggestions
As the push for sustainability continues to gain momentum, the future of modern kitchen textiles looks promising. Industry standards are evolving, pushing manufacturers to adopt innovative practices that minimize environmental impact. New technological advancements may lead to even more sustainable materials becoming available, allowing brands to broaden their product lines.
For professionals in the industry or potential customers, it is crucial to keep abreast of these trends and consider the long-term benefits of investing in modern kitchen textiles. It is essential to seek out brands committed to transparency in their supply chains and production methods—demanding certifications such as G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) or OEKO-TEX can further ensure the products you choose meet high environmental standards.
